||||리습기능은요
1. 이 리습은 치수가 블럭화되어 있지않고 그냥 치수선과 치수문자가
    분리되어 그려줍니다.
2. 단선치수,및 다중치수가 가능하고요
   치수선끝에 버블및 주열번호까지 한번에 그릴수있습니다.
3. 수평칫수-DH명령 상하부에 그릴수있고요
    수직치수-DV영령 좌우측에 그릴수있어요

R14에서는 사용가능 하고요
2000에서는 치수선만 그려지고 치수text가 안써지면서 이런 메세지가뜨네요
error: incorrect object to bind: T


참 좋은 리습인데 그냥 버리기가 넘아까워요
아무리봐도 이상해요
R11부터 R14까지 잘 쓰던것이 왜 안되는지.
